But many of us *love* to argue about taxonomies and word meanings (it's cheaper than booze anyway). *8) To my mind, if the attacker needs to be logged into an account on the machine being attacked then the vulnerability is local; if the attacker just has to be able to push bits to a port then it's remote. If the attacker has to trick a legitimate user into doing something (including going to a particular remote site) then it's a Trojan horse. Not hard and fast boundaries (what if the attacker has to first push some bits to a port and then fool a user into clicking on a link in some email and then log into a local account?), but to first order...
